抱歉,我无法提供此请求的具体内容。 但我可以

                          发布时间:2024-10-25 09:45:39
                          ```

                          简介

                          区块链技术的发展推动了数字货币的普及,而数字钱包作为用户与区块链交互的桥梁,其重要性不言而喻。开发一个钱包DApp不仅能满足用户对安全、便捷的需求,还能为开发者带来丰厚的收益及个人成就感。本文将详细阐述区块链钱包DApp的开发过程,包括技术栈的选择、开发步骤、以及成功的关键因素。

                          一、区块链钱包DApp的概述

                          区块链钱包DApp是一种基于区块链技术的去中心化应用,使用户能够安全地存储、发送和接收数字货币。与传统钱包相比,区块链钱包的优势在于其去中心化的特性,可以降低第三方干预的风险,并增强用户的隐私保护。

                          二、开发钱包DApp所需的技术栈

                          在开始开发之前,选择合适的技术栈至关重要。以下是开发区块链钱包DApp常用的技术:
                          1. **区块链平台**:以以太坊、波卡、币安智能链等为基础。
                          2. **开发语言**:JavaScript、Solidity(以太坊智能合约开发语言)、Python等。
                          3. **前端框架**:React、Vue.js等。
                          4. **后端框架**:Node.js、Express等。
                          5. **数据库**:可以使用MongoDB存储用户数据。

                          三、开发流程

                          开发钱包DApp的流程主要分为以下几步:
                          1. **需求分析**:明确用户需求、市场分析和功能设置。
                          2. **设计原型**:使用工具如Figma设计DApp界面原型。
                          3. **智能合约开发**:编写并测试以太坊智能合约,处理Token转账等功能。
                          4. **前端开发**:根据设计原型进行前端开发,实现用户交互功能。
                          5. **后端开发**:搭建服务器,处理数据存储以及与区块链的交互。
                          6. **测试和**:对整个DApp进行功能测试、性能和安全审计。
                          7. **部署上链**:将应用部署到主网,同时发布相关的文档和支持资料。

                          四、成功的关键因素

                          在钱包DApp的开发过程中,以下几个因素是决定成功与否的关键:
                          1. **安全性**:钱包DApp关乎用户资产,安全性是重中之重。需要定期进行安全审计和漏洞检测。
                          2. **用户体验**:用户界面的友好性和操作的简便性将决定用户的使用频率。
                          3. **社区反馈**:倾听社区的反馈并做出相应的调整和,以提升用户满意度。
                          4. **合规性**:注意遵循所在地区的法律法规,避免法律风险。

                          五、常见问题解释

                          1. 开发钱包DApp需要哪些编程知识?

                          开发钱包DApp主要需要掌握以下编程知识:
                          - **JavaScript**:有效地与区块链交互。
                          - **Solidity**:编写以太坊智能合约。
                          - **前端框架**:如React或Vue.js,用于开发用户界面。
                          - **后端开发**:如Node.js,处理数据存储和API接口。

                          2. 如何保证钱包DApp的安全性?

                          钱包DApp的安全性涉及多个方面,包括但不限于:
                          - 定期进行安全审核。
                          - 实施多重签名技术。
                          - 整合现代加密算法,保护用户数据。
                          - 定期更新和修补安全漏洞。

                          3. 钱包DApp如何进行测试?

                          对钱包DApp进行测试包括以下几种方式:
                          - **单元测试**:确保每一个功能模块都能正常工作。
                          - **集成测试**:测试系统的各个部分如何协作。
                          - **用户测试**:邀请真实用户进行体验反馈。
                          - **压力测试**:测试在高并发下的表现,判断系统的稳定性。

                          4. 不同区块链平台的优势和劣势是什么?

                          不同区块链平台都有各自的特点:
                          - **以太坊**:强大的开发者社区和丰富的工具,但交易费用较高。
                          - **波卡**:支持多链结构,灵活性高,但相对开发复杂。
                          - **币安智能链**:交易费用低,快速,适合入门,但去中心化程度相对较低。

                          5. 如何推动钱包DApp的用户增长?

                          推动用户增长的方法包括:
                          - **流量引导**:使用和内容营销提升曝光率。
                          - **用户激励**:提供转账返现等活动吸引用户。
                          - **社群营销**:建立社群,增强用户粘性。
                          - **联合推广**:与其他项目合作,进行交叉推广。

                          结语:开发区块链钱包DApp虽然面临技术和市场的多重挑战,但也充满了机遇。希望本文能够帮助你在这个领域获得成功。

                          分享 :
                          
                                  
                            author

                            tpwallet

                            T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                          相关新闻

                                          个人加密钱包如何取消:
                                          2025-02-11
                                          个人加密钱包如何取消:

                                          ### 个人加密钱包如何取消:全面指南与注意事项 近年来,加密货币的飞速发展让越来越多的人开始关注个人加密钱包...

                                          Ledger官方旗舰店:安全管
                                          2025-03-03
                                          Ledger官方旗舰店:安全管

                                          随着数字货币的飞速发展,越来越多的人开始投资加密资产。然而,随之而来的安全隐患也日益凸显。为了保障投资...

                                          探索开源加密钱包:安全
                                          2024-11-06
                                          探索开源加密钱包:安全

                                          引言 在数字货币迅猛发展的今天,加密钱包成为了每一个投资者和用户不可或缺的工具。特别是开源加密钱包,以其...

                                          加密货币如何安全有效地
                                          2024-11-22
                                          加密货币如何安全有效地

                                          随着加密货币的普及,越来越多的人开始关注如何安全地存储他们的数字资产。冷钱包是一种备受推崇的存储方式,...